Kronstadt has signed a state contract for the development of a draft design of the Thunder UAV

The device is designed to work as a wingman in an advanced attacking echelon in cooperation with manned aviation Moscow, August 23.

/tass/. The Kronstadt company has started work on a state contract for the development of a draft design of a multi-purpose high-speed unmanned aerial vehicle (UAV) "Thunder", first presented in 2020. This was reported to TASS in the press service of the enterprise at the last forum "Army-2022".

"We already have concluded state contracts for the development of a draft design, we are working in this direction," the press service said in response to a question about the stage at which work on the Thunder UAV is at.

"Thunder" was first shown at the Army 2020 forum, it is designed to work as a wingman in the advanced attacking echelon in cooperation with manned aircraft. The robot is capable of provoking military and object air defense complexes, and after they begin to actively search for it, destroy them with their strike means. It can also fight surface ships and coastal infrastructure facilities. In one of the variants, it will be capable of carrying X-38 guided missiles of the air-to-surface class.

Also, the Thunder UAV is one system with reusable high-speed group-use drones "Lightning", it is able to control a swarm of 10 such devices. At the same time, as noted in the company, the "Lightning" will "communicate" with each other and with the carrier drone. It is possible to change tasks for each member of the "pack", transfer leadership roles, interchangeability and execution of tasks by a group without constant communication with the carrier aircraft - thanks to artificial intelligence.

Kronstadt JSC is a full production cycle enterprise for the creation of drones from their design to testing and certification. Since its establishment in 1991, the company (formerly known as CJSC Transas) has specialized in the development of airborne, land and sea systems, military equipment simulators and interactive complexes. The company has developed the Orion-E UAV, Sirius and a number of other devices.

The International Military-Technical Forum "Army-2022" was held from August 15 to 21 at the Patriot Exhibition Center. The event was organized by the Russian Defense Ministry.
